About Deepak Kumar
Deepak Kumar is a scholar working on Molecular Biology, Plant Science, Endocrinology, Diabetes and Metabolism, Complementary and alternative medicine and Food Science, having authored 76 papers that have together received 1.4k indexed citations. Recurring topics across this work include Natural Antidiabetic Agents Studies (11 papers), Natural product bioactivities and synthesis (10 papers), Essential Oils and Antimicrobial Activity (6 papers), Ethnobotanical and Medicinal Plants Studies (5 papers), RNA modifications and cancer (5 papers), Phytochemistry and Biological Activities (5 papers), RNA Research and Splicing (4 papers) and Phytochemicals and Medicinal Plants (4 papers). The work is most often cited by research in Biochemistry (113 citations), Endocrinology, Diabetes and Metabolism (144 citations), Molecular Biology (629 citations), Cancer Research (128 citations) and Complementary and alternative medicine (66 citations). Deepak Kumar has collaborated with scholars based in India, United States and Japan. Frequent co-authors include Bikas C. Pal, Rina Ghosh, J. R. Vedasiromoni, Sumana Mallick, Bimal K. Ray, Alpana Ray, Raghuvir H. Gaonkar, Rinku Baishya, Sumantra Das and Amit Kumar Srivastava. Their work appears in journals such as The Journal of Immunology, Journal of Biological Chemistry, Journal of Functional Foods, Journal of Ethnopharmacology and Materials Horizons.
